>>>WHOA! Slow down before you drop the indexes. Indexes are not totally
>>>useless! It very much depends on the queries you run against your
>>>database. If you are doing a mixture of queries, where some return single
>>>rows or a very small subset of data, and some return a large number of
>>>rows, you still should keep the indexes for the first type of query.

>>>> > Sorry... I thought most people knew this. Oracle says that if a
>>>> query will
>>>> > return more than 20% of the rows of a table, it will use a full table
>>>>scan.
>>>> > So you DON'T tune it to use an index. In fact, as of 8i, I believe
>>>> Oracle
>>>> > now recommends that if a query returns as little as 3-5% of a table, a
>>>>full
>>>> > table scan is the way to go.
